FAX (918) 781-7217 Why Does Bacone Seek Private Support?Bacone College is over 120 years old and has never accepted any direct funds from the state or federal government. Bacone's students are eligible for grants and loans and some of the Native American students qualify for tribal loans. Bacone is a financially sound institution and is a very good place to invest in the future of Native American students and others to help insure the future of our world. Tuition fees generate revenue for the College. However, the money from tuition and fees does not cover the entire cost of operating the College. Gift income helps to keep the cost of tuition affordable as well as to fund the cost of improvements to facilities, increase course offerings and improve programs, and provide scholarship dollars for needy students. Support from alumni, parents, churches and other friends makes possible the academic extras which allow Bacone College to maximize the educational experience of each student, facilitate academic initiatives, foster research and underwrite program and technology initiatives. Planned GivingAlumni, parents and friends who believe in the mission of Bacone College and who want to help it advance may not be aware of the different ways that their obligations to family, retirement needs and future income can be improved by planned giving. What is a planned gift? A planned gift is usually made from a donor's assets rather than from current income. It is given to or provided for Bacone College while the donor is still living. It may even provide current income and tax benefits to the donor and/or the donor's beneficiaries. The money is generally not available to the College until some future date, usually at the death of the donor and/or the donor's beneficiaries.
